SB022b Installs antivirus on all compatible personal (i.e. non workplace) devices

Antivirus/Endpoint protection programs provide excellent coverage against known online threats. They should be deployed also on all compatible personal devices.


Why is it important?

Devices require protection. Antivirus helps protect against many known malware variants and other online threats.
